Description

Eucalyptus guilfoylei,commonly known as yellow tingle or dingul dingul,is a species of tree native to Western Australia.It will often grows up to 40 m tall,with a diameter up to 1 metre.but can grow as tall as 60 m (197 ft).It is rarely harvested for timber,but has previously been used for sleepers,poles or bridge timbers.
